So.. we had to wait for a call from Mark from the garage to see if Gramps was okay. We decided to spend our time in the library until he would call, so that we could answer some mails and write on the blog. Apparently, Auckland has 17 libraries (!) and we were walking distance from the Central City Library. Little did we know that using the internet at that library is somewhat similar to slowly walking barefoot on a pool of burning coals – ridiculously slow and agonizing. We literally only managed to click about 3 times per half an hour, and we walked away rather frustrated and unaccomplished. Travelers – do avoid the internet in that library. We learned later on that smaller towns yield MUCH better results.
